Error Rate Percentage is a metric that measures the proportion of errors or defects in a given sample or population. It expresses the error frequency as a percentage of the total number of observations, providing a standardized way to assess quality and performance across different contexts.

Q1: What Is Considered A Good Error Rate?
A: Acceptable error rates vary by industry and context. In manufacturing, rates below 1% are often targeted, while in data entry, rates below 0.5% may be acceptable. Always compare against industry standards.
Q2: How Can I Reduce Error Rates?
A: Implement quality control measures, provide proper training, use automation where possible, establish clear procedures, and conduct regular audits to identify and address root causes of errors.
Q3: Should I Use This For Statistical Analysis?
A: While useful for basic calculations, for formal statistical analysis consider confidence intervals, statistical significance testing, and other advanced metrics to ensure robust conclusions.
Q4: What If My Error Rate Is Zero?
A: A zero error rate may indicate excellent performance, but could also suggest insufficient testing or detection methods. Ensure your sampling and detection methods are adequate.
Q5: Can This Be Used For Process Capability Analysis?
A: Error rate percentage is a basic quality metric. For comprehensive process capability analysis, additional statistical tools like Six Sigma methodologies and control charts are recommended.
